What Is a Direct Mailing Service?
A direct mailing service is a platform or solution that helps businesses send physical mail—letters, postcards, brochures, or other printed materials—to their target audience efficiently. These services often come with automation, targeting, personalization, and tracking features.
Some key capabilities of modern direct mailing services include:
- Design Templates & Personalization: Customize content for each recipient using variable data printing.
- Bulk Mailing: Send thousands of letters in just a few clicks.
- Print-On-Demand: Print and mail without the need for inventory.
- Integrated Tracking: Get real-time updates on delivery status.
- CRM Integrations: Connect with tools like Salesforce, HubSpot, or Zoho for streamlined campaigns.
These platforms eliminate the need for manual printing, envelope stuffing, and post office runs—making it an invaluable resource for marketing teams and administrative staff alike.
The Role of Address Verification in Mailing Accuracy
One of the biggest pitfalls in direct mail is address inaccuracy. According to USPS, millions of mail pieces are marked “undeliverable as addressed” every year. That’s wasted effort, money, and opportunity.
That’s where tools like an address checker API come into play.
An address checker API is a real-time software solution that validates, standardizes, and corrects mailing addresses before the mail is sent. It integrates directly with your CRM, eCommerce platform, or mailing software to ensure the addresses you’re using are accurate and deliverable.
Benefits of Using an Address Checker API
Here are some compelling advantages of using an address verification API alongside your mailing strategy:
1. Enhanced Deliverability
Invalid or outdated addresses are automatically corrected or flagged, ensuring your mail reaches the right destination.
2. Reduced Mailing Costs
By eliminating undeliverable addresses, you cut back on printing and postage waste.
3. Real-Time Validation
Whether you’re collecting addresses through online forms or customer databases, the API checks them instantly and fixes errors on the spot.
4. Standardization
Addresses are formatted to match postal standards (like USPS or Canada Post), which is critical for bulk mail discounts and efficient processing.
5. Global Coverage
Some APIs support international address validation, making global mail campaigns more accessible and reliable.
Use Case: Direct Mail + Address Checker API in Action
Let’s consider a healthcare clinic launching a flu shot awareness campaign. They want to reach all previous patients within a 10-mile radius. Here’s how integrating these tools can help:
- Segment the List: Use CRM data to identify the target audience.
- Verify Addresses: Run the data through an address checker API to remove invalid addresses.
- Personalize Mail: Use a direct mailing service to create customized postcards reminding patients of flu season and offering a free consultation.
- Automate Sending: Schedule the campaign and track delivery through the mailing platform.
- Analyze Response: Use promo codes or QR tracking to measure campaign effectiveness.
The result? A higher ROI, reduced waste, and improved patient engagement.
